Prioritizing safety is crucial, as accidents involving loss of life are tragic events with profound consequences. To reduce the risk of fatalities, it is essential to adhere to traffic laws, maintain a safe following distance, and avoid aggressive driving behaviors. Regular vehicle inspections are necessary to ensure the vehicle is in good working condition and address any mechanical issues promptly. Investing in driver training is also recommended, focusing on safe driving practices, defensive driving, and awareness of the challenges associated with operating large commercial vehicles. Proper load securement is crucial to prevent shifting during transit and reduce the risk of accidents caused by unsecured cargo. Advanced safety technologies, such as collision avoidance systems, lane departure warnings, and automatic emergency braking, can help prevent accidents and mitigate their severity. Adequate rest is also important, with policies that prioritize driver rest and limit driving hours to prevent fatigue-related accidents.
